"""
@author: bfx
@version: 1.0.0
@file: orchestrator.py.py
@time: 4/25/25 15:12
"""
# orchestrator.py
import json
import time
from typing import Dict, List, Any
from mcp.protocol import MCPMessage
from agents.base import BaseAgent
class Orchestrator:
"""Manages communication flow between agents"""
def __init__(self, agents: List[BaseAgent]):
self.agents = {agent.agent_id: agent for agent in agents}
self.conversation_history: List[MCPMessage] = []
def _record_message(self, message: MCPMessage):
"""Add message to conversation history"""
self.conversation_history.append(message)
def send_message(self, from_agent_id: str, to_agent_id: str, message: MCPMessage):
"""Send message from one agent to another"""
# Record the message
self._record_message(message)
# Add message to receiving agent's context
to_agent = self.agents[to_agent_id]
to_agent.add_message(message)
def run_workflow(self, initial_query: str, max_turns: int = 3) -> List[Dict[str, Any]]:
"""Run the multi-agent workflow for a set number of turns"""
print(f"Starting workflow with query: {initial_query}")
# Get agent IDs for convenience
agent_ids = list(self.agents.keys())
researcher_id = agent_ids[0]
synthesizer_id = agent_ids[1]
# Start with initial query to researcher
researcher = self.agents[researcher_id]
user_msg = MCPMessage(
role="user",
content=initial_query,
agent_id="human",
)
researcher.add_message(user_msg)
self._record_message(user_msg)
print(f"\n[Human → {researcher.name}]: {initial_query}")
# Run the workflow for specified turns
for turn in range(max_turns):
print(f"\n--- Turn {turn + 1} ---")
# Researcher agent generates response
print(f"\n[{researcher.name} thinking...]")
research_response = researcher.generate_response()
print(f"[{researcher.name}]: {research_response.content[:150]}...")
# Send researcher's response to synthesizer
synthesizer = self.agents[synthesizer_id]
self.send_message(researcher_id, synthesizer_id, research_response)
# Create prompt for synthesizer
synth_prompt = f"Based on the research provided, please synthesize the key points and provide a critical analysis."
synth_msg = MCPMessage(
role="user",
content=synth_prompt,
agent_id="orchestrator",
references=[research_response.message_id],
metadata={"type": "instruction"}
)
synthesizer.add_message(synth_msg)
self._record_message(synth_msg)
# Synthesizer generates response
print(f"\n[{synthesizer.name} thinking...]")
synthesis_response = synthesizer.generate_response()
print(f"[{synthesizer.name}]: {synthesis_response.content[:150]}...")
# Send synthesizer's response back to researcher for next turn
self.send_message(synthesizer_id, researcher_id, synthesis_response)
# Update query for researcher's next turn
if turn < max_turns - 1:
followup_prompt = f"Consider the synthesis and critique above. Please investigate further on any gaps or areas that need more explanation."
followup_msg = MCPMessage(
role="user",
content=followup_prompt,
agent_id="orchestrator",
references=[synthesis_response.message_id],
metadata={"type": "instruction"}
)
researcher.add_message(followup_msg)
self._record_message(followup_msg)
# Convert conversation history to simplified format for return
formatted_history = []
for msg in self.conversation_history:
agent_name = "Human"
if msg.agent_id in self.agents:
agent_name = self.agents[msg.agent_id].name
elif msg.agent_id == "orchestrator":
agent_name = "Orchestrator"
formatted_history.append({
"agent": agent_name,
"role": msg.role,
"content": msg.content,
"message_id": msg.message_id,
"references": msg.references
})
return formatted_history
def save_transcript(self, filename: str = "mcp_transcript.json"):
"""Save the conversation transcript to a file"""
formatted_history = []
for msg in self.conversation_history:
agent_name = "Human"
if msg.agent_id in self.agents:
agent_name = self.agents[msg.agent_id].name
elif msg.agent_id == "orchestrator":
agent_name = "Orchestrator"
formatted_history.append({
"agent": agent_name,
"role": msg.role,
"content": msg.content,
"message_id": msg.message_id,
"references": msg.references,
"timestamp": msg.timestamp
})
with open(filename, "w") as f:
json.dump(formatted_history, f, indent=2)
print(f"Transcript saved to {filename}")
